Output 82d5bd0e356129258ad60aef0212f51e0889dda627f5a50e0d00da8802a5fed4:9

value
29810215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b27d87e51e24a81b71ffbf1d5b21a75fd91a6 OP_EQUAL
address
3P4WQjhPxVXdFphzDZk37Kd7UfwFtitdSJ
transaction
82d5bd0e356129258ad60aef0212f51e0889dda627f5a50e0d00da8802a5fed4
spent
true